New Mexico Economy

Agriculture provides a considerable source of income for New Mexico. The most important agricultural industry is ranching. Ranches throughout the state make use of land that is too steep or too rocky for growing crops. Cattle and sheep thrive on the open range year round. Major crops of hay and sorghum are grown in the dry climate. Pinto beans, piñon nuts, and chili peppers are also raised.

New Mexico’s mineral wealth includes natural resources used for energy production. Reserves of natural gas, uranium, petroleum, and coal are found here. Large amounts of potash – a fertilizer material – are mined as well as manganese, copper, silver, and turquoise.

New Mexico’s beautiful country, national forests, and historic sites make it an attractive destination for tourists. The tourism industry is a significant source of income for the state.

More than 25% of New Mexico’s residents work for the federal government at air force bases, national observatories, and laboratories throughout the state. The temperate climate and growing population continue to attract many new manufacturing industries to the state, especially those related to the defense industry.
